What singing lessons cost in St. Louis
Private voice lessons in St. Louis typically run $40–$90 per hour. Newer teachers, 30-minute lessons, and online sessions cost less; experienced coaches who prep performers cost more. Classical, musical theater, worship, blues-influenced pop.
The St. Louis singing scene
- Community choirs. Church and community choirs welcome adult singers of all levels and are a cheap way to sing weekly.
- Community theater. Active community theater in St. Louis drives steady demand for audition prep and belt technique.
- University programs. Webster and Washington University run voice programs; grad students and faculty-adjacent teachers often offer affordable lessons in St. Louis.
How to choose a vocal coach in St. Louis
- Pick a teacher trained in teaching voice, not just someone with a performance résumé.
- Take a trial lesson first. You should leave feeling clearer and more motivated, not confused.
- Red flag:your throat hurts or you're hoarse after lessons. That means bad technique — leave.
- Red flag: months pass with the same feedback and no progress. Good coaches always give you a clear next step.

Are online or in-person lessons better?
Both work. In-person makes posture and breath corrections easier; online is cheaper and more flexible. Many local coaches offer both.
